Publisher Description: "How Did They Die? Murders in Northern Texas 1926-1975," is the second in the series for author Julie Williams Coley. Follow 40 murder cases that were so heinous, many of the convicted received the death penalty. Many of the stories are well known legends throughout the North Texas area. This book is a great companion book to "How Did They Die? Murders in Northern Texas 1892-1926," published in 2009.
